Description
The Joyce Henricks Paper Prize in Women and Gender Studies was named for the Women and Gender Studies program’s founder, Dr. Joyce Henricks, the WGS prize honors excellent undergraduate work in the field.
Benefits
The scholarship offers a $250 amount, to help you with your studies.
Eligibility
- Applicants must be current CMU students, but do not have to be WGS majors or minors.
- Submissions may take the form of a research paper or a creative endeavor that represents an original contribution to the study of Women and Gender Studies.
- The submission should represent a substantial scholarly or creative endeavor.
- A student may not submit more than one paper or creative endeavor.
- The submission can be from any CMU class. The student should submit the course assignment and/or criteria given by the professor.
- Papers may not exceed 20 pages in length. Bibliography and table pages are not counted.
- Creative endeavors should be documented in a portfolio of up to 10 images or one video file. Please create a single PDF with all images or links. Details of a large piece may be included at the applicant’s discretion. Each work must be clearly identified as follows: Title of work / Medium / Dimensions.
- Papers co-authored by faculty at this institution or at another institution are not eligible.
